Rapid technological advancements
The integration of technologies, such as the IoT, AI, robotics, and big data analytics, which have transformed mining operations, is propelling the market growth. IoT enables real-time monitoring of mining equipment and environmental conditions, improving operational efficiency and safety. As per the report, the number of IoT devices is expected to reach approximately 18.8 Billion at the end of 2024. In addition to this, AI is utilized in predictive maintenance, which foresees equipment failures prior to their occurrence, thereby reducing downtime and prolonging equipment lifespan. Moreover, robotics, particularly through automated drilling and ore management, improves accuracy and minimizes human participation in dangerous activities. Additionally, big data analytics enable the processing of massive quantities of data produced in mining operations, resulting in valuable decisions that enhance productivity and resource management.

Surface mining holds 64.6% of the market share. Surface mining dominates the market due to its extensive applications in extracting minerals and ore that are near the earth's surface. It includes various methods, such as open-pit mining, strip mining, and mountaintop removal. Smart technologies are used in these mining operations to enhance efficiency and improve safety. Automated trucks and conveyor belt monitoring systems streamline operations and reduce labor costs. Additionally, the relatively straightforward layout of surface mines allows for easier deployment of IoT devices, sensors, and AI-driven analytics. With increasing pressure to cut costs and meet environmental regulations, surface mining operations are adopting smart technologies to minimize waste and reduce their carbon footprint. The vast and open environments in surface mines provide a conducive setting for deploying drones and advanced surveying tools for monitoring, mapping, and ensuring regulatory compliance.

Excavator holds 32.2% of the market share. The excavator segment holds the largest market share, reflecting its extensive use in various mining operations. Modern excavators in smart mining are equipped with advanced technologies, such as global positioning systems (GPS), the IoT connectivity, and artificial AI-based solutions, enhancing their efficiency and effectiveness. These advanced excavators can carry out intricate operations, including excavation, material management, and soil displacement, with great accuracy and reduced human involvement. They are able to assess the landscape, enhance their maneuvers, and collaborate effortlessly with other machinery, such as haul trucks, resulting in a well-coordinated mining operation. Automated excavators decrease the necessity for operators in dangerous settings, lowering the likelihood of accidents. They also provide reliable performance, in contrast to manual tasks that can be influenced by exhaustion or human mistakes.
